Music’s “Madman Genius” Dead at 69: RIP William Orbit
Producer and musician William Orbit has died at the age of 69, his family announced. Best known for his influential work with Madonna and other major artists, Orbit’s death marks the loss of a producer widely credited with helping shape modern pop and electronic music.
His family said he died at home on 23 July, with no cause of death disclosed, and requested privacy. Orbit reportedly contributed to more than 200 million album sales and co-wrote several tracks on Madonna’s successful 1998 album Ray of Light, whose sound she attributed to his experimental, “madman genius” approach.
